§ 773.173. DUTIES OF BOARD; RULES. (a) On the
recommendation of the advisory committee, the board shall adopt
minimum standards and objectives to implement a pediatric emergency
services system, including rules that:
(1) provide guidelines for categorization of a
facility's pediatric capability;
(2) provide for triage, transfer, and transportation
policies for pediatric care;
(3) establish guidelines for:
(A) prehospital care management for triage and
transportation of a pediatric patient;
(B) prehospital and hospital equipment that is
necessary and appropriate for the care of a pediatric patient;
(C) necessary pediatric emergency equipment and
training in long-term care facilities; and
(D) an interhospital transfer system for a
critically ill or injured pediatric patient; and
(4) provide for data collection and analysis.
(b) The board and the advisory committee shall consider
guidelines endorsed by the American Academy of Pediatrics and the
American College of Surgeons in recommending and adopting rules
under this section.
(c) The bureau may grant an exception to a rule adopted
under this section if it finds that compliance with the rule would
not be in the best interests of persons served in the affected local
pediatric emergency medical services system.
(d) This subchapter does not prohibit a health care facility
from providing services that it is authorized to provide under a
license issued to the facility by the department.
Added by Acts 1993, 73rd Leg., ch. 513, § 1, eff. Aug. 30, 1993.
